John II Casimir, 18 groschen 1653, Posen

VF+/XF-
add Your note 
Lot description Show orginal version
Grade: VF+/XF-
Reference: Szatalin PZ53-I-8, Kopicki 1723 (R1), Kamiński-Kurpiewski 346 (R3)

A nice piece with a perfectly struck reverse in patina on both sides.

Obverse: in the pearl rim a royal bust wearing a crown, armor and cloak studded with jewels, with the Order of the Golden Fleece, to the right, in the outer rim the legend:
IOAN-CASIMI-D:G REX-POL & SVEC-M-D-L-R-P;

Reverse: in the pearl rim crowned with a five-pointed crown with 5 jewels in an open rim with 5 rosette fleurons, a five-pointed decorative shield with the coats of arms of the Crown, the Grand Duchy of Lithuania and the coat of arms of the Snopes of the Vasa dynasty, the sides denominations 1-8 and initials A-T, in the outer rim a legend punctuated by the Wieniawa coat of arms:
MON-NOV-REG-POL--POSNAN-FAC-1653;
